Discussion

  • In view of low somatic maintenance, pseudodata k_J = 0.002 1/d is replaced by pseudodata k = 0.3

Facts

  • preferred temperature 22 C; (Ref: fishbase)
  • 50-1100 m deep, usually 150-600 m deep. Bathydemersal, larvae and juveniles are pelagic (Ref: Wiki)
  • zygoparous (intermediate between oviparity and viviparity) (Ref: Wiki)
  • length-weight: W = 0.014*L^3.091 (Ref: fishbase)
